Commit ddd0d14bceab240b930f00a8a5a8e376d54993cf

Authored by Ioana Ciornei
Committed by Priyanka Jain
1 parent f4d394c416

configs: ls1088ardb: enable PHYLIB and related through Kconfig

Starting with commit 7d9701db4089 ("cmd: mdio/mii: add Kconfig help and
allow break dependency"), CMD_MDIO depends on the PHYLIB Kconfig which
should be enabled properly from the Kconfig and not through any define
from a header file.

Move all LS1088ARDB configs to enable PHYLIB and related through
Kconfig options. Also, remove the defines from the header file so that
we do not redefine the same symbol.

Signed-off-by: Ioana Ciornei <ioana.ciornei@nxp.com>

Showing 7 changed files with 31 additions and 15 deletions Side-by-side Diff

configs/ls1088ardb_qspi_SECURE_BOOT_defconfig
... ... @@ -40,8 +40,14 @@
40 40 # CONFIG_SPI_FLASH_BAR is not set
41 41 CONFIG_SPI_FLASH_SPANSION=y
42 42 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  43 +CONFIG_PHYLIB=y
  44 +CONFIG_PHY_AQUANTIA=y
  45 +CONFIG_PHY_REALTEK=y
  46 +CONFIG_PHY_TERANETICS=y
  47 +CONFIG_PHY_VITESSE=y
43 48 CONFIG_E1000=y
44 49 CONFIG_MII=y
  50 +CONFIG_NVME=y
45 51 CONFIG_PCI=y
46 52 CONFIG_DM_PCI=y
47 53 CONFIG_DM_PCI_COMPAT=y
... ... @@ -61,6 +67,4 @@
61 67 CONFIG_RSA=y
62 68 CONFIG_RSA_SOFTWARE_EXP=y
63 69 CONFIG_EFI_LOADER_BOUNCE_BUFFER=y
64   -CONFIG_CMD_NVME=y
65   -CONFIG_NVME=y
configs/ls1088ardb_qspi_defconfig
... ... @@ -43,8 +43,14 @@
43 43 # CONFIG_SPI_FLASH_BAR is not set
44 44 CONFIG_SPI_FLASH_SPANSION=y
45 45 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  46 +CONFIG_PHYLIB=y
  47 +CONFIG_PHY_AQUANTIA=y
  48 +CONFIG_PHY_REALTEK=y
  49 +CONFIG_PHY_TERANETICS=y
  50 +CONFIG_PHY_VITESSE=y
46 51 CONFIG_E1000=y
47 52 CONFIG_MII=y
  53 +CONFIG_NVME=y
48 54 CONFIG_PCI=y
49 55 CONFIG_DM_PCI=y
50 56 CONFIG_DM_PCI_COMPAT=y
... ... @@ -62,6 +68,4 @@
62 68 CONFIG_USB_DWC3=y
63 69 CONFIG_USB_GADGET=y
64 70 CONFIG_EFI_LOADER_BOUNCE_BUFFER=y
65   -CONFIG_CMD_NVME=y
66   -CONFIG_NVME=y
configs/ls1088ardb_sdcard_qspi_SECURE_BOOT_defconfig
... ... @@ -52,6 +52,11 @@
52 52 # CONFIG_SPI_FLASH_BAR is not set
53 53 CONFIG_SPI_FLASH_SPANSION=y
54 54 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  55 +CONFIG_PHYLIB=y
  56 +CONFIG_PHY_AQUANTIA=y
  57 +CONFIG_PHY_REALTEK=y
  58 +CONFIG_PHY_TERANETICS=y
  59 +CONFIG_PHY_VITESSE=y
55 60 CONFIG_E1000=y
56 61 CONFIG_MII=y
57 62 CONFIG_PCI=y
... ... @@ -70,6 +75,4 @@
70 75 CONFIG_USB_DWC3=y
71 76 CONFIG_RSA=y
72 77 CONFIG_SPL_RSA=y
73   -CONFIG_CMD_NVME=y
74   -CONFIG_NVME=y
configs/ls1088ardb_sdcard_qspi_defconfig
... ... @@ -53,8 +53,14 @@
53 53 # CONFIG_SPI_FLASH_BAR is not set
54 54 CONFIG_SPI_FLASH_SPANSION=y
55 55 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  56 +CONFIG_PHYLIB=y
  57 +CONFIG_PHY_AQUANTIA=y
  58 +CONFIG_PHY_REALTEK=y
  59 +CONFIG_PHY_TERANETICS=y
  60 +CONFIG_PHY_VITESSE=y
56 61 CONFIG_E1000=y
57 62 CONFIG_MII=y
  63 +CONFIG_NVME=y
58 64 CONFIG_PCI=y
59 65 CONFIG_DM_PCI=y
60 66 CONFIG_DM_PCI_COMPAT=y
... ... @@ -71,6 +77,4 @@
71 77 CONFIG_USB_XHCI_DWC3=y
72 78 CONFIG_USB_DWC3=y
73 79 CONFIG_USB_GADGET=y
74   -CONFIG_CMD_NVME=y
75   -CONFIG_NVME=y
configs/ls1088ardb_tfa_SECURE_BOOT_defconfig
... ... @@ -47,8 +47,12 @@
47 47 # CONFIG_SPI_FLASH_BAR is not set
48 48 CONFIG_SPI_FLASH_SPANSION=y
49 49 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  50 +CONFIG_PHYLIB=y
  51 +CONFIG_PHY_AQUANTIA=y
  52 +CONFIG_PHY_VITESSE=y
50 53 CONFIG_E1000=y
51 54 CONFIG_MII=y
  55 +CONFIG_NVME=y
52 56 CONFIG_PCI=y
53 57 CONFIG_DM_PCI=y
54 58 CONFIG_DM_PCI_COMPAT=y
... ... @@ -71,6 +75,4 @@
71 75 CONFIG_SPL_RSA=y
72 76 CONFIG_RSA_SOFTWARE_EXP=y
73 77 CONFIG_EFI_LOADER_BOUNCE_BUFFER=y
74   -CONFIG_CMD_NVME=y
75   -CONFIG_NVME=y
configs/ls1088ardb_tfa_defconfig
... ... @@ -52,8 +52,12 @@
52 52 # CONFIG_SPI_FLASH_BAR is not set
53 53 CONFIG_SPI_FLASH_SPANSION=y
54 54 # CONFIG_SPI_FLASH_USE_4K_SECTORS is not set
  55 +CONFIG_PHYLIB=y
  56 +CONFIG_PHY_AQUANTIA=y
  57 +CONFIG_PHY_VITESSE=y
55 58 CONFIG_E1000=y
56 59 CONFIG_MII=y
  60 +CONFIG_NVME=y
57 61 CONFIG_PCI=y
58 62 CONFIG_DM_PCI=y
59 63 CONFIG_DM_PCI_COMPAT=y
... ... @@ -77,6 +81,4 @@
77 81 CONFIG_USB_ETHER_ASIX88179=y
78 82 CONFIG_USB_ETHER_RTL8152=y
79 83 CONFIG_EFI_LOADER_BOUNCE_BUFFER=y
80   -CONFIG_CMD_NVME=y
81   -CONFIG_NVME=y
include/configs/ls1088ardb.h
... ... @@ -504,9 +504,7 @@
504 504  
505 505 /* MAC/PHY configuration */
506 506 #ifdef CONFIG_FSL_MC_ENET
507   -#define CONFIG_PHYLIB
508 507  
509   -#define CONFIG_PHY_VITESSE
510 508 #define AQ_PHY_ADDR1 0x00
511 509 #define AQR105_IRQ_MASK 0x00000004
512 510  
... ... @@ -520,7 +518,6 @@
520 518 #define QSGMII2_PORT4_PHY_ADDR 0x1f
521 519  
522 520 #define CONFIG_ETHPRIME "DPMAC1@xgmii"
523   -#define CONFIG_PHY_GIGE
524 521 #endif
525 522 #endif
526 523